A Victor man and woman were sent to F.F. Thompson Hospital Aug. 31 after a motorcycle crash on Routes 5 and 20 and Moran Road in Canandaigua, said Ontario County sheriff’s deputies.
According to police, Alan Perotta, 60, of Victor, was traveling east on Routes 5 and 20 on a 2003 Harley Davidson. While stopped at a traffic light, a vehicle that was behind the motorcycle — operated by Katherine M. Gleason, 33, of East Chester — started faster than Perotta, and ran into the back of his vehicle, police said.
Perotta, and his passenger Karen Perotta, also of Victor, were transported to Thompson by the Canandaigua Ambulance. Both were wearing helmets.
Gleason was charged with several traffic violations, including following too closely, and for texting while driving, deputies said.
